Once you register, you'll receive an express posted basket weaving kit hand-picked by Desert-Rain Magpie to use in the course featuring: 1 x Weaving needle 1 x Natural raffia 5 x Coloured raffia 1 x Certificate of participation The ticket price for the course is $195.00 all-inclusive Non-indigenous people are encouraged to participate. Murray Martin, who was integral to the growth and success of the Brasstown carvers, was trained as an occupational therapist. Growing up in Mossman and Cow Bay, Delissa was taught by her grandmother how to make traditional baskets 'balji' out of the native black palm tree 'kakan'. From its beginnings in 1995 as a series of basket-making workshops on the Ngaanyatjarra Lands in WA, it has evolved into a group creating award-winning sculptural masterpieces including a giant Toyota and the Australian coat of arms.
